Output 318c0cfc916d8dab038ccea369e13781f714228924bdb6ef9d486bcc5826b9f3:1

value
19997548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 442e3458eb149adbb9291634af04a48a8cc3dcd0 OP_EQUAL
address
37uXDw1A7tSd4iqfVWpVPvJKv6ViYL4XtQ
transaction
318c0cfc916d8dab038ccea369e13781f714228924bdb6ef9d486bcc5826b9f3
confirmations
421499
spent
true